What is the process of the soft-pack lithium-ion battery?

What is the process of the soft-packed lithium-ion battery? 1. Soft-packed batteries The soft-packed batteries are batteries that use aluminum-plastic film as the packaging material. The important packaging rheumatic heat packaging, the reason why laser welding is not used is that the packaging material of aluminum-plastic film is easier to encapsulate and shape than the outer packaging of steel or aluminum shell. 2. Aluminum-plastic packaging film Aluminum-plastic packaging film is actually aluminum-plastic film, which has a three-layer structure of nylon layer, AI layer and PP layer. Each layer has its corresponding purpose. The overall purpose of the aluminum-plastic packaging film is to protect the battery cell. The purpose of the AI u200bu200blayer is to prevent water infiltration. The nylon layer ensures that the shape of the aluminum-plastic film will not change, while the PP layer is actually heat-encapsulated. The material, PP, is polyethylene, which will melt and bond together under heating, and will solidify after cooling to achieve the purpose of encapsulation. 3. Aluminum-plastic film molding Aluminum-plastic film molding is a well-known process of mold opening and molding. This process is also called punching. Use the forming mold to punch out a pit capable of holding telecommunications under heating. 4. Top and side sealing process This process includes top sealing and side sealing. It should be noted that this process will leave an air bag opening for the next step of liquid injection. But the important thing is the top seal. The top seal is to seal the tabs. The tabs are made of metal (aluminum anode and nickel cathode). How can they be packaged with PP? This is done by a small part of the lug on the lug. The tab glue has the cost of PP, which means that it can be melted and bonded when heated. During packaging, the PP in the tab glue and the PP layer of the aluminum-plastic film melt and bond to form an effective packaging structure. Lithium-ion battery 5. Liquid injection and pre-sealing process After the top-side sealing process is completed, the liquid injection and pre-sealing processes must be carried out within the standing time. The liquid injection is very simple, that is, inject the electrolyte into the aluminum plastic film, and then Pre-package quickly (preliminary package, also called one). After the pre-sealing is completed, the inside of the cell is theoretically isolated from the outside. 6. After the completion of the fifth process of standing + forming + fixture shaping process, it is necessary to let the electrolyte fully infiltrate the pole piece by standing at high temperature and normal temperature, and then take the cell to be formed (equivalent to cell activation, Gas will appear again). Fixture shaping is actually because some factories use fixture formation, so that the formed electrode interface is better, but it has the disadvantage of deformation. The fixture shaping process is also called baking. 7. The second sealing process is due to the formation of gas, so there will be the second sealing process. In the second seal, the air bag is first pierced by a guillotine and the vacuum is drawn at the same time, so that the gas and a small part of the electrolyte in the air bag will be drawn out. Then immediately the second sealing head is encapsulated in the second sealing area to ensure the air tightness of the cell. Finally, cut off the air bag of the encapsulated cell, and a soft-packed cell is basically formed. 8. Follow-up process The follow-up process is trimming, disassembling, dividing (capacity test), checking appearance, pasting yellow glue, edge voltage testing, tab transfer welding, OQC inspection, packaging and shipping, etc. Disclaimer: Some pictures and content of the articles published on this site are from the Internet.
